  • Catalogue Essay

    The present pair of ceiling light comprises 36 individual glass elements that can be assembled in different configurations, an approach that was developed by Venini in the mid-1930s under the artistic direction of the architect Carlo Scarpa. The specific design of the present examples is recorded in the Catalogo Blu as 'Cordonato rigato' glass, patented by Venini as number 333411.
